AI Analysis

Atlanta holds a clear edge in pitching with Reynaldo López (ERA 3.31, WHIP 1.30, 4-1) facing a struggling Mets offense (.228/.668 vs RHP, 3.7 R/G in L10). The Braves own a 52-36 record with strong team ERA (3.53) and RA/G (3.81). Their lineup hits .252/.733 vs RHP and features multiple quality bats in Olson, Harris II, and a hot Mauricio Dubón (L14 .340). New York's Peralta has been inconsistent (ERA 4.81, WHIP 1.42) and the Mets lineup has multiple cold spots (Baty, Vientos, Torrens). At -132, there is slight negative value to consider, but the pitching and team quality gap is real.
